Recommended for
CodeCombat is recommended for beginners, especially younger individuals or students, who are interested in learning programming in a gamified environment. It's particularly suitable for those who enjoy visual learning and interactive challenges.

It often comes down to compat, and developer requests. Personally I find in-browser encoding for images inadequate, because it doesn't expose enough options. When we built https://squoosh.app/, we exposed the browser encoders for... - Source: Hacker News / 19 days ago
Its a fun challenge. I used https://squoosh.app to make a pretty good one. Mostly just a resize and then OxiPNG for compression. Managed a 124x62 black/white image. OP has a resolution of 195x53, so I had very similar, but slightly worse... - Source: Hacker News / 2 months ago

CheckIO is a web site with a mission: To teach JavaScript and Python coding skills through a game-playing interface. It is designed to teach new skills or improve existing skills through completing challenges.
